A great Pinot is delicate, not too dark, complex on the palate with gentle tannins. The flavors expand from the center of your palate outward. Pinot Noir is also one of the easiest wines to pair with food, as it goes with almost everything.

Sangiovese will remind you of strawberries. The other grapes in the blend add depth, pie spice, and finish. If the meal is Italian, Sangiovese is perfect.

The Dry Creek Valley in Sonoma County is one of the best places on the planet to grow Zinfandel. This Zinfandel is a powerful wine, robust, spicy and concentrated.
